Job summary

Join our Estates & Compliance Team as an Estates Monitoring Officer, managing outsourced Hard Facilities Management (Hard FM) contracts to ensure high-quality estates services, sustainability, and a positive patient experience across our sites.

Main duties of the job

  • Develop and maintain the Estates Monitoring Plan aligned with contract standards.

  • Feed user feedback (concerns, complaints, incidents) into the monitoring process.

  • Supply data and analysis for contract variations and cost implications.

  • Participate in contract review meetings and support Trust-wide reporting systems.

  • Provide administrative support tocolleagues where required.

  • Uphold Trust sustainability priorities in everyday operations.

Job description

Job responsibilities

In this role, you will:

  • Monitor contract compliance, KPIs, and SLAs.

  • Investigate incidents, complaints, and maintain the Hard FM risk register.

  • Support and develop systems for contract monitoring, including planned and ad hoc audits.

  • Review monthly reports and verify submitted performance data.

  • Liaise with departments, contractors, and Trust teams.

  • Prepare briefing papers and present findings to senior Estates staff.

  • Identify trends, highlight service gaps, and escalate contract, safety, or compliance issues promptly.

  • Contribute to quality assurance and Trust-wide reporting.

  • Gather PFI data to support service variations and financial performance tracking.

  • Lead sustainability initiatives to reduce carbon and energy footprints in Hard FM services.

Person Specification

Qualifications

Essential

  • GCSE Grade C and above in English Language and Mathematics.
  • Knowledge of MS Office applications by appropriate course.

Desirable

  • BTEC in Business Studies or similar.

Experience

Essential

  • Experience of carrying out quality assurance audits. Good working experience of Facilities Management. Experience of carrying out audits against standardised documentation.

Desirable

  • Experience within the health service, or related area. Experience of working within an Estates environment. Trade experience in electrical, mechanical or building.
